Output 4e580443056a1de13f28bed1c9789059c6df4470be696d1ae4f659d4431c7c9f:11

value
34663615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fba088ff3c1c795b26c48c7c3e0542f371c42d41 OP_EQUAL
address
3QdVqsStGL1c7fv796pXgrtr7tsH9pnZ8T
transaction
4e580443056a1de13f28bed1c9789059c6df4470be696d1ae4f659d4431c7c9f
spent
true